He is thought to be responsible for the importation of large amounts of cocaine from Colombia which are reportedly airdropped into the Caribbean, divided into smaller quantities, and transported by couriers to Atlanta, Georgia, and other cities in the United States. WASHINGTON, April 25 (UPI) -- The FBI Thursday placed James Spencer Springette, the alleged leader of a Caribbean drug smuggling ring, on its "Ten Most Wanted Fugitives" list. Springette had been on the run since March 2000, when Colombian authorities say he escaped from jail. He started out selling juice to tourists on the island of St. Thomas in the U.S. Virgin Islands and ended up distributing thousands of kilos of cocaine into the United States.
